Frequently Asked Questions
Do I need to have the system evacuated before removing the old condenser?
Yes. Your AC system must be properly discharged by a certified technician before disconnecting any refrigerant lines. Improper handling can damage the compressor and is illegal in most states. Once the old unit is out and lines are capped, the new condenser installs at the same mounting points, then the system gets recharged.
Will this condenser work if my original one is just clogged, not leaking?
A clogged condenser loses cooling efficiency but isn't always a reason to replace it — flushing the system might restore flow. If you've confirmed the condenser is internally restricted and cleaning doesn't help, replacement is the right move. This unit gives you a fresh start with full cooling capacity.
